Patagonia Sues Drag Queen Pattie Gonia - Scrolling w/ Hayley (Ep. 310)

June 2, 2026·1h 3m
Episode Description from the Publisher

In this episode of Scrolling: It’s primary election day in LA - will voters vote blue no matter who? Then, Patagonia sues a drag queen for trademark infringement. Plus, Hooters is rebranding as a family friendly restaurant. I’m not so sure this is possible! Watch me LIVE on Rumble.
